Как восстановить PrismCuBE RUBY после неудачной прошивки
Вы можете самостоятельно восстановить аппарат если во время прошивки что то пошло не так и тюнер завис с работающим вентилятором и горящим красным светодиодом.
Предупреждение: последующие дальше действия могут повлечь за собой прекращение гарантийных обязательств от продавца или производителя оборудования. Все что вы делаете – на свой страх и риск. Если у вас не достаточно квалификации – лучше обратиться в сервис центр.
Для восстановления ресивера вам понадобится перемычка (можно временно снять со своего компьютера
NULL modem кабель (9Pin) это при условии что ваш компьютер оборудован серийным портом. Можно использовать и USB-COM переходник.
USB флэшка отформатированная в FAT32. Желательно использовать флэшку постарей и иметь несколько штук на выбор, т.к. Ruby очень придирчив к флэшкам.
У вас должен быть установлен Hyperterminal (ну или его аналог на ваш выбор)
Итак приступим.
Первым делом выключаем компьютер, выключаем ресивер, отключаем от ресивера блок питания.
Снимаем с ресивера крышку.
Под крышку видим системную плату ресивера.
Находим контакты перемычки JP9 (UART_BOOT) и надеваем на них перемычку.
Подсоединяем NULL modem кабель к com порту ресивера и компьютера.
Загружаем компьютер. Ресивер пока не включаем!
Запускаем hyperterm и создаем новое соединение. Выбираем com порт к котором подключен ресивер.
И устанавливаем скорость соединения Baud Rate 115200 8n1
(Ресивер пока не включайте)
С официального сайта скачиваем последний Emergency Update. Например последний.
И распаковываем его в директорию /update_ruby/ на нашу фдэшку.
Вставляем USB флэшку в ресивер. (он все еще выключен)
Включаем блок питания в ресивер.
В окне hyperterm в левом верхнем углу должны начать появляться буквочки ССС.
В меню hyperterm выбираем «Transfer” – “Send file”, жмем кнопочку “Browse” и выбираем файл uldr.bin.uartboot_img распакованный из uldr.bin.zip
В меню “Protocol” выбираем YMODEM и жмем “Send”
Дожидаемся конца передачи файла
В консоли hyperterm видим
Ждем пока ресивер обработает первый файл uldr.bin.uartboot_img
(опять буквочки СССС)
И далее повторяем процедуру только передаем u-boot.bin из архива u-boot.zip
После того как u-boot загрузится ресивер сам начнет прошивать recovery image.
RUBY очень придирчив к флэшкам. Чем старей флэшка тем лучше. Внимательно следите за надписями в консоли hyperterm! Если вы видите надпись типа "scanning bus for storage devices..." и дальше "1 Storage Device(s) found" это означает что флэшка определилась. Если что то другое – пробуйте использовать другую флэшку.
После того как ресивер прошил recovery image вы видите надпись Remove USB.
Выключаете ресивер.
Снимаете перемычку с JP9
Надеваем назад крышку. Ура!
Вы можете самостоятельно восстановить аппарат если во время прошивки что то пошло не так и тюнер завис с работающим вентилятором и горящим красным светодиодом.
Предупреждение: последующие дальше действия могут повлечь за собой прекращение гарантийных обязательств от продавца или производителя оборудования. Все что вы делаете – на свой страх и риск. Если у вас не достаточно квалификации – лучше обратиться в сервис центр.
Для восстановления ресивера вам понадобится перемычка (можно временно снять со своего компьютера
NULL modem кабель (9Pin) это при условии что ваш компьютер оборудован серийным портом. Можно использовать и USB-COM переходник.
USB флэшка отформатированная в FAT32. Желательно использовать флэшку постарей и иметь несколько штук на выбор, т.к. Ruby очень придирчив к флэшкам.
У вас должен быть установлен Hyperterminal (ну или его аналог на ваш выбор)
Итак приступим.
Первым делом выключаем компьютер, выключаем ресивер, отключаем от ресивера блок питания.
Снимаем с ресивера крышку.
Под крышку видим системную плату ресивера.
Находим контакты перемычки JP9 (UART_BOOT) и надеваем на них перемычку.
Подсоединяем NULL modem кабель к com порту ресивера и компьютера.
Загружаем компьютер. Ресивер пока не включаем!
Запускаем hyperterm и создаем новое соединение. Выбираем com порт к котором подключен ресивер.
И устанавливаем скорость соединения Baud Rate 115200 8n1
(Ресивер пока не включайте)
С официального сайта скачиваем последний Emergency Update. Например последний.
И распаковываем его в директорию /update_ruby/ на нашу фдэшку.
Вставляем USB флэшку в ресивер. (он все еще выключен)
Включаем блок питания в ресивер.
В окне hyperterm в левом верхнем углу должны начать появляться буквочки ССС.
В меню hyperterm выбираем «Transfer” – “Send file”, жмем кнопочку “Browse” и выбираем файл uldr.bin.uartboot_img распакованный из uldr.bin.zip
В меню “Protocol” выбираем YMODEM и жмем “Send”
Дожидаемся конца передачи файла
В консоли hyperterm видим
Ждем пока ресивер обработает первый файл uldr.bin.uartboot_img
(опять буквочки СССС)
И далее повторяем процедуру только передаем u-boot.bin из архива u-boot.zip
После того как u-boot загрузится ресивер сам начнет прошивать recovery image.
RUBY очень придирчив к флэшкам. Чем старей флэшка тем лучше. Внимательно следите за надписями в консоли hyperterm! Если вы видите надпись типа "scanning bus for storage devices..." и дальше "1 Storage Device(s) found" это означает что флэшка определилась. Если что то другое – пробуйте использовать другую флэшку.
После того как ресивер прошил recovery image вы видите надпись Remove USB.
Выключаете ресивер.
Снимаете перемычку с JP9
Надеваем назад крышку. Ура!
Вложения
Последнее редактирование: